The H323 Profile settings, continued...
H323 Profile [1..1] Authentication Mode
Set the authenticatin mode for the H.323 profile.
ADMIN
Requires user role:
<On/Off>
Value space:
On: If the H.323 Gatekeeper Authentication Mode is set to On and a H.323 Gatekeeper indicates that
it requires authentication, the system will try to authenticate itself to the gatekeeper. NOTE: Requires
the Authentication LoginName and Authentication Password to be defined on both the codec and
the Gatekeeper.
Off: If the H.323 Gatekeeper Authentication Mode is set to Off the system will not try to authenticate
itself to a H.323 Gatekeeper, but will still try a normal registration.
xConfiguration H323 Profile 1 Authentication Mode: Off
Example:

Set the Ethernet link speed.
ADMIN
Requires user role:
<Auto/10half/10full/100half/100full/1000full>
Value space:
Auto: Autonegotiate link speed.
10half: Force link to 10Mbps half-duplex.
10full: Force link to 10Mbps full-duplex.
100half: Force link to 100Mbps half-duplex.
100full: Force link to 100Mbps full-duplex.
1000full: Force link to 1Gbps full-duplex.
xConfiguration Network 1 Speed: Auto
Example:
Define whether to use DHCP or Static IPv4 assignment.
ADMIN
Requires user role:
<Static/DHCP>
Value space:
Static: Set the network assignment to Static and configure the static IPv4 settings (IP Address,
SubnetMask and Gateway).
DHCP: The system addresses are automatically assigned by the DHCP server.
xConfiguration Network 1 Assignment: DHCP
Example:
Select which internet protocols the system will support.
Requires user role:
ADMIN
Value space:
<IPv4/IPv6>
IPv4: IP version 4 is supported.
IPv6: IP version 6 is supported. The IPv4 settings (IP Address, IP Subnet Mask and Gateway) will be
disabled.
Example:
xConfiguration Network 1 IPStack: IPv4
